Federer and Nadal cried after the match, which was the last in the career of the Swiss – Tennis

Roger Federer spent last match of his careerin the Laver Cup losing a doubles match along with Rafael Nadal.

After the game, the audience gave the Swiss an ovation that lasted several minutes. The 20-time Grand Slam champion burst into tears at that moment.

Federer invited the entire team to the court during a standing ovation Europe. After hugging the Swiss, Nadal cried.

And also shed a tear Stefanos Tsitsipas.
